    See What 6,599 MPH *ON LAND* Looks Like!!

    This is a hypersonic sled traveling 6,599 mph (mach 8.6 = 9,465 feet per second) on the USAF high speed test track at Holloman AFB in New Mexico. Thought you fellas might enjoy this..

    Quote Originally Posted by tinsnips View Post
    What is that sled used for?
    It's a test bed for various things.

    There's some cool films of them using it with the front end of different jet fighters to develop and test ejection seats.
    But as far as I know, they didn't send them much over Mach 1 for those.
    Above certain speeds, the human simulated/stressed dummies had their arms rip off when exiting the cockpit.
